IT is Key Enabler of Corporate Responsibility, Sustainability: Report

By Anuradha Shukla
TMCnet Contributor

A recent Deloitte online poll reportedly showed that more than 40 percent of employees believe their company's information technology department is very involved in corporate responsibility and sustainability efforts. Energy and carbon management were top concerns of the IT department, according to the respondents.

 
The poll examined how enterprise sustainability initiatives, including energy and carbon management programs, have significant impacts and implications for information technology groups. 
 
Lee Dittmar, principal, Deloitte (News - Alert) Consulting, said that companies today are relying more on CIOs to help drive business strategies and innovation. The poll indicates that enterprises have begun to see IT as an essential enabler of sustainability efforts throughout the company.
 
Deloitte Consulting has observed that providing technology to manage and report on enterprise-wide energy use and carbon emissions is present on the agendas of chief information officers more frequently now. They are also more focused on determining how IT can serve as the foundational platform to manage corporate responsibility and sustainability initiatives.
 
Dittmar said that in addition to providing sustainability measurement and reporting tool sets, CIOs need to be prepared to make the case for IT's role in managing and improving sustainability strategies, programs and initiatives. He suggested that the senior technology executives should try to establish baseline measurements, determine information needs to measure progress at all levels, ensure information availability and accessibility as well as evaluate IT capabilities to measure, monitor and report CR&S.
 
The recent Deloitte and CFO Research Services study, "The Next Wave of Green IT," identified an information quality gap between IT and finance executives and Knox said this gap can be narrowed if the organizations leverage IT as a driver and enabler of enterprise sustainability.
